Tech firm evacuates 2 sites as coronavirus infection rises to 3 in Hyderabad





The number of coronavirus infections in Hyderabad rose to three on Wednesday with two persons testing positive in preliminary checks, an official statement from Telangana’s Public Health and Family Welfare department said.
The latest infection also forced a tech company to evacuate two of its campuses in the city after one of its employees tested positive.
The samples of the two persons have been sent to the National Virology Laboratory in Pune for confirmation.
Of the two, one has travel history to Italy. The other is a contact of the 24-year old techie who tested positive for the virus on Monday.
The two had undergone preliminary tests at Hyderabad’s state-run Gandhi hospital. The state public health and family welfare department said that the results of additional tests on the two sent to NVL, Pune are expected on Thursday.
More than 40 people who had come in contact with the affected techie have been kept under observation. On Monday, 47 people including these people had undergone the tests. While 45 tested negative, two tested positive.
One of the two person who has tested positive is an employee of DSM Shared Services and the company in a statement said, “We would like to inform you that one of our DSM colleagues in our Hyderabad office at Mindspace building has been diagnosed with Coronavirus. This diagnosis was confirmed early this morning. We are regularly checking on the colleague who is in hospital as well as family members to ensure everyone is doing fine.”
The company’s offices in two tech campuses of the city Raheja Mindspace and Brightspace are being cleansed and disinfected thoroughly, the company added. It said till everything was sorted out it had asked its employees to work from home as the sites were closed.
The Telangana government has put in place 3,000 beds for isolation and close to 300 beds for patients requiring treatment.
The health officials also began publicising the preventive measures being taken to ensure that the virus doesn’t spread.
Meanwhile the BJP announced that a public rally of Union Home Minister Amit Shah which was scheduled for 15 March in Hyderabad has been postponed to a future date. Party’s Chief Spokesperson for Telangana said “This decision was taken to reduce mass physical contact of people during the public rally in the current context of serious precautions being undertaken by the Centre to arrest spread of Corona virus.”
